Pride Richland County hosts a community program fittingly named "Free to be", which is a community support group that welcomes all young adults ages 13-21, no matter their orientation or identity.
Free 2 Be provides support and a safe space. During meetings, there is always an open forum to be able to discuss any topics that are part of everyday life for today’s youth during their time of self-discovery.
Some common topics that are discussed are healthy relationships, validations, body positivity and self-worth, suicide prevention, unrealistic expectations of stigmas and bias, and positive self-talk.
